Which of the following statements are TRUE?
 
  a. There must be a direct relationship between the annual goals and the present levels of performance.
  b. Annual goals focus on addressing needs resulting from the disability so that the student can appropriately participate in the general curriculum.
  c. Goals should be considered from all areas of the student's individual needs, including those associated with behavior and long-term adult outcomes, where appropriate.
  d. All of the above are true

For about 100 years, scientists thought that peptic ulcers were caused by stress, spicy food, and alcohol. Later, researchers added stomach acid to the list of causes and began treating ulcers with antacids. Now it is known that peptic ulcers are predominantly caused by Helicobacter pylori, a spiral-shaped bacterium that normally exist in the stomach.
